TMS Evolution Marks Major Shift in Logistics Technology Strategy
Transportation management systems are crossing a threshold in 2026 that fundamentally changes how 3PLs and shippers approach logistics technology. What started as tools for executing shipments and tracking loads is transforming into sophisticated decision-support platforms that can guide strategic choices in real-time.
The transformation is being powered by three converging forces: artificial intelligence capabilities that can process massive datasets and identify optimization opportunities, automation that handles routine decisions without human intervention, and evolving carrier networks that require more sophisticated management approaches.
For 3PL operators, this shift represents both an opportunity and a challenge. Modern TMS platforms now offer predictive analytics that can forecast capacity constraints, recommend optimal carrier selections based on historical performance data, and automatically adjust routing decisions as conditions change. The systems are moving from answering "what happened" to predicting "what will happen" and suggesting "what should we do about it."
The practical implications are significant. Where logistics managers once spent hours analyzing reports and making manual adjustments, AI-enhanced TMS platforms can now surface insights and recommendations proactively. This frees up experienced staff to focus on exception handling and strategic relationship management rather than routine optimization tasks.
The carrier network dynamics driving this change reflect the industry's ongoing fragmentation and consolidation cycles. As carrier options multiply and service levels vary more widely, the ability to make data-driven carrier selections becomes increasingly valuable. TMS platforms that can learn from millions of shipment outcomes and apply those lessons to future decisions provide a competitive edge that manual processes simply can't match.
